How water flows away from pregnant women

You need to be aware that not every time the membranes are torn at the time of the onset of contractions.

  • If the amniotic fluid is poured out before the contractions begin, then it is considered that it happened prematurely.
  • In the case when there is an active labor activity, but the cervix has not yet opened wide, the outpouring of water is called early.
  • In the case of the disclosure of the cervix to a width of 4 cm, amniotic fluid is poured out in a timely manner.
  • It happens that the membranes do not break during childbirth, then the doctor opens them manually.

It is very important to assess the amount of amniotic fluid that has flowed out and their appearance. Amniotic water before childbirth has a volume of about one and a half liters. But not all of this liquid is poured out at once. Usually, only part of the waters immediately leaves, they at the same time push the baby to the exit from the birth canal. The rest of the amniotic fluid will come out with birth child, making it easier for him to pass through the birth canal.

If the rupture of the amniotic bladder occurs from the side or from above, then the amniotic fluid leaves slowly, in small portions. In this case, the woman often cannot interpret the situation correctly.

Green or black staining of amniotic fluid indicates the presence of traces of meconium in them. If the amniotic fluid is reddish, then there are traces of blood in it, which most likely indicates that there is a placental abruption.

How long does it take to give birth, if the water has departed

When the amniotic water is poured out, a woman needs to urgently come to the maternity hospital or hospital. The reason for such a rush is simple - an urgent need to assess the condition fetus and the woman herself. The doctor will conduct an examination and conclude about the onset of labor and the condition of the baby. Indeed, sometimes a woman may simply not feel the contractions that have begun. In rare cases, with the outflow of amniotic fluid, the umbilical cord loops fall out, which can lead to the death of the baby.
